Sonowal calls on Gogoi, to take oath on May 24

Guwahati: The BJP’s chief minister designate Sarbananda Sonowal on Sunday called on outgoing Assam chief minister Tarun Gogoi at the latter’s official residence to invite him to the swearing-in ceremony of the new ministry to be held on May 24 next.
Sonowal also requested Gogoi to advise the new government in course of discharging its responsibility in coming days. Sonowal was accompanied by senior BJP leaders including party’s general secretary Ram Madhab.
Meanwhile, the Governor of Assam PB Acharya by virtue of powers vested in him by clause (1) of Article 164 of the Constitution of India on Sunday appointed Sarbananda Sonowal to be the next chief minister of Assam vides order no. GSAG/SS Govt/2016 dtd. 22/05/16.
Sarbananda Sonowal after being elected as the leader of the BJP Legislature Party on Sunday called on the Governor and handed over the letter of support of 86 newly elected representative of the 126 member House of Assam Legislative Assembly. Dr Himanta Bishwa Sarmah proposed the name of Sonowal as the leader of the BJP legislature party.
The AGP with 14 MLAs and BPF with 12 MLAs have extended support to BJP to form the Government.
